.m_b37d9ac7{width:calc(100% - var(--mantine-spacing-md) * 2);z-index:var(--notifications-z-index);max-width:var(--notifications-container-width);position:fixed}.m_b37d9ac7:where([data-position=top-center]){top:var(--mantine-spacing-md);left:50%;transform:translate(-50%)}.m_b37d9ac7:where([data-position=top-left]){top:var(--mantine-spacing-md);left:var(--mantine-spacing-md)}.m_b37d9ac7:where([data-position=top-right]){top:var(--mantine-spacing-md);right:var(--mantine-spacing-md)}.m_b37d9ac7:where([data-position=bottom-center]){bottom:var(--mantine-spacing-md);left:50%;transform:translate(-50%)}.m_b37d9ac7:where([data-position=bottom-left]){bottom:var(--mantine-spacing-md);left:var(--mantine-spacing-md)}.m_b37d9ac7:where([data-position=bottom-right]){bottom:var(--mantine-spacing-md);right:var(--mantine-spacing-md)}.m_5ed0edd0+.m_5ed0edd0{margin-top:var(--mantine-spacing-md)}
.crash-screen{box-sizing:border-box;color:#f8fafc;min-height:100vh;padding:calc(env(safe-area-inset-top,0px) + 16px) 14px calc(env(safe-area-inset-bottom,0px) + 18px);z-index:1000002;background:radial-gradient(circle at 20% 0,#2563eb24,#0000 32%),linear-gradient(#111827 0%,#0f172a 58%,#070b14 100%);font-family:Inter,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,sans-serif;position:relative;overflow:auto}.crash-shell{max-width:760px;margin:0 auto}.crash-header{justify-content:space-between;align-items:flex-start;gap:14px;margin-bottom:14px;display:flex}.crash-header h1{color:#fff;letter-spacing:0;margin:10px 0 8px;font-size:28px;font-weight:900;line-height:1}.crash-header p{color:#cbd5e1;overflow-wrap:anywhere;margin:0;font-size:14px;font-weight:650;line-height:1.35}.crash-pill{letter-spacing:.04em;text-transform:uppercase;border-radius:999px;padding:5px 9px;font-size:11px;font-weight:900;display:inline-flex}.crash-pill.is-danger{color:#fca5a5;background:#ef444429}.crash-pill.is-warn{color:#fcd34d;background:#f59e0b29}.crash-copy-main,.crash-reload,.crash-secondary{cursor:pointer;border:0;border-radius:10px;flex:none;min-height:40px;padding:0 13px;font-size:13px;font-weight:900}.crash-copy-main,.crash-reload{color:#fff;background:#2563eb}.crash-secondary{color:#dbeafe;background:#ffffff14}.crash-summary-grid{background:#0f172ae0;border:1px solid #94a3b82e;border-radius:14px;grid-template-columns:repeat(2,minmax(0,1fr));gap:1px;margin-bottom:14px;display:grid;overflow:hidden}.crash-ai-bar{background:#2563eb1f;border:1px solid #60a5fa42;border-radius:12px;align-items:center;gap:10px;margin-bottom:14px;padding:10px;display:flex}.crash-ai-bar button{color:#fff;background:#1d4ed8;border:0;border-radius:9px;flex:none;min-height:34px;padding:0 11px;font-size:12px;font-weight:900}.crash-ai-bar button:disabled{cursor:wait;opacity:.68}.crash-ai-bar span{color:#bfdbfe;font-size:12px;font-weight:700;line-height:1.3}.crash-summary-grid div{background:#1e293b80;min-width:0;padding:12px}.crash-summary-grid span{color:#94a3b8;text-transform:uppercase;margin-bottom:6px;font-size:11px;font-weight:850;line-height:1;display:block}.crash-summary-grid strong{color:#f8fafc;overflow-wrap:anywhere;font-size:13px;font-weight:800;line-height:1.25;display:block}.crash-tabs{grid-template-columns:repeat(5,minmax(0,1fr));gap:6px;margin-bottom:12px;display:grid}.crash-tabs button{color:#cbd5e1;background:#ffffff0f;border:1px solid #94a3b824;border-radius:9px;height:36px;font-size:12px;font-weight:850}.crash-tabs button.is-active{color:#dbeafe;background:#2563eb3d;border-color:#60a5fa7a}.crash-section{background:#0f172ae0;border:1px solid #94a3b829;border-radius:14px;margin-bottom:12px;overflow:hidden}.crash-section h2{color:#fff;letter-spacing:.02em;text-transform:uppercase;border-bottom:1px solid #94a3b821;margin:0;padding:11px 12px;font-size:13px;font-weight:900}.crash-cause,.crash-muted{color:#cbd5e1;margin:0;padding:12px;font-size:14px;font-weight:650;line-height:1.45}.crash-muted{color:#94a3b8}.crash-code{color:#dbeafe;white-space:pre-wrap;word-break:break-word;background:#020617;max-height:42vh;margin:0;padding:12px;font-family:JetBrains Mono,ui-monospace,SFMono-Regular,Menlo,Monaco,Consolas,monospace;font-size:11px;line-height:1.45;overflow:auto}.crash-file-list,.crash-list{flex-direction:column;gap:1px;display:flex}.crash-file-list div,.crash-list-row{background:#1e293b70;padding:10px 12px}.crash-file-list strong,.crash-list-row strong{color:#e2e8f0;overflow-wrap:anywhere;font-size:13px;font-weight:850;display:block}.crash-file-list span,.crash-list-row span,.crash-list-row em{color:#94a3b8;margin-top:4px;font-size:11px;font-style:normal;font-weight:700;display:block}.crash-ai-result{color:#dbeafe;padding:12px}.crash-ai-result h3{color:#fff;margin:0 0 12px;font-size:15px;font-weight:900;line-height:1.35}.crash-ai-result p,.crash-ai-result li{color:#cbd5e1;font-size:13px;font-weight:650;line-height:1.45}.crash-ai-result ol,.crash-ai-result ul{margin:8px 0 12px;padding-left:20px}.crash-ai-result>strong{color:#fff;text-transform:uppercase;margin-top:10px;font-size:12px;font-weight:900;display:block}.crash-actions{gap:9px;padding-top:4px;display:flex}.crash-actions button{flex:1}@media (max-width:520px){.crash-header{display:block}.crash-copy-main{width:100%;margin-top:12px}.crash-summary-grid{grid-template-columns:1fr}.crash-ai-bar{flex-direction:column;align-items:stretch}.crash-tabs{gap:5px}.crash-tabs button{height:34px;padding:0 2px;font-size:11px}.crash-actions{flex-direction:column}}
